In this CPU comparison, we compare the AMD GX-412HC and the Intel Xeon Gold 6238R and use benchmarks to check which processor is faster.

We compare the AMD GX-412HC 4 core processor released in Q2/2014 with the Intel Xeon Gold 6238R which has 28 CPU cores and was introduced in Q1/2020.

CPU Cores and Base Frequency

The AMD GX-412HC is a 4 core processor with a clock frequency of 1.20 GHz (1.60 GHz). The processor can compute 4 threads at the same time. The Intel Xeon Gold 6238R clocks with 2.20 GHz (4.00 GHz), has 28 CPU cores and can calculate 56 threads in parallel.

Memory & PCIe

Up to 16 GB of memory in a maximum of 1 memory channels is supported by the AMD GX-412HC, while the Intel Xeon Gold 6238R supports a maximum of 1024 GB of memory with a maximum memory bandwidth of 140.7 GB/s enabled.

Thermal Management

The AMD GX-412HC has a TDP of 7 W. The TDP of the Intel Xeon Gold 6238R is 165 W. System integrators use the TDP of the processor as a guide when dimensioning the cooling solution.

Technical details

The AMD GX-412HC has 2.00 MB cache and is manufactured in 28 nm. The cache of Intel Xeon Gold 6238R is at 38.50 MB. The processor is manufactured in 14 nm.
